It happened. It finally happened. After 1,043 days between Misano 2021 and Aragon 2024, after four surgeries, two bouts of diplopia, an arm twisted 32 degrees and a changed sport, Marc Marquez is FINALLY back to winning ways and he did it in DOMINANT fashion.

Aragon was Marc's weekend. He dominated every single session of the weekend barring a wet Sunday warm-up, qualified on pole by eight-tenths of a second and then hit the Bagnaia in Assen - A Super Grand Slam to have the fastest lap while leading every single lap en route to taking all 37 points on the weekend. It was a masterpiece, and the boys break it all down on this episode.

It also reviews the worst weekend of the year so far for Pecco Bagnaia. A dud front tyre and two awful starts from his dirty pitbox led to him barely hanging on for a point in the Sprint, before a tangle with Alex Marquez took him out of what looked like a guaranteed third place. With Martin back in the Championship lead, is the Spaniard the favourite again? And are we STILL in a Rossi/Marquez feud nearly a decade on?
